yocto-queue

Yocto-queue is a tiny queue data structure that provides efficient enqueue and dequeue operations. It is ideal for scenarios where frequent additions and removals from the front of a list are required, outperforming standard arrays in performance for large datasets. This package fits well in applications needing a FIFO data structure for managing tasks or events.
